Summary
COBRA is the continuation of current health coverage under the WELS VEBA Group Health Care Plan. COBRA may be available if a Qualifying Event occurs which would cause the member to be ineligible for health benefits. Health plan benefits provided while under COBRA coverage are the same as those benefits provided by the WELS VEBA.
Election Period
The member must inform the Benefit Plans Office within 60 days of their Qualifying Event in order to be eligible to elect COBRA. The member then has 60 days from the date of the Qualifying Event or the date that the Benefit Plans Office provides Notice to the Member of the Qualifying Event and the Member's rights, whichever is later, to elect COBRA coverage.
If COBRA is elected within this time period, the member then has 45 days after the election date to pay the initial premium.
Duration of COBRA coverage
COBRA coverage may be available for 18, 29, or 36 months, depending on the Qualifying Event. Please contact the Benefit Plans Office or review the WELS VEBA plan for more information regarding the duration of COBRA coverage.
Qualifying Events
A qualifying event means the end of the calendar quarter in which the following event occurs:
- The Member dies
- The Member terminates employment or is terminated for reasons other than gross misconduct
- The Member is ineligible as a result of reduced working hours
- The Member's spouse is ineligible as a result of divorce or legal separation
- The Member is entitled to benefits under Medicare
- A Dependent child is no longer a Dependent under the terms of the Plan
- The Member notifies the Sponsoring Organization that he or she will not return or fails to return from FMLA leave
